Up for your bidding pleasure is this museum quality reclining Pre Columbian Colima dog that dates to 100 B.C. to 250 A.D. according to the appraiser that examined the item for the family. From the well known and historic estate of Frank Ward Hustace Jr.- the Victoria Ward heir, this was purchased with lots of other interesting items including a wonderful lot of Mexican jewelry that we sold a couple of weeks ago on ebay. The attention to detail in this ceramic is amazing, including wonderful life like features even on the bottom. A true rarity that measures 3 1/8" greatest height and 9 1/4" in length, it was buried in shaft tombs in the western part of Mexico and after doing some research is modeled after a Techichi or Escincle- relatives of the modern day Chihuahua or Mexican hairless dog.
